This isn't a zero sum punishment system. You getting a punishment doesn't make their behavior acceptable or not punishable.

But the simple fact of the matter is that trolling through gameplay is much harder to detect and catch. Any automatic system (and/or manual review) has to account for people who unintentionally play really poorly.

I would recommend you toss a support ticket to Riot telling them about the situation and the person you wish to report. Doing so will increase the chances that a manual review is done which will be far better than an automatic review at detecting trolling.
